How to check if your car has 225 50 R17 tyres
All tyres have a specific code imprinted on the sidewall, this code tells you the size and dimensions of the tyre.
In the case of 225/50 R17 tyres the numbers tell us it is 225mm wide, sidewall distance from rim to tread of 50% of the overall width and it fits to an 17-inch wheel. You'll also see a letter which describes the tyre's construction, either 'R for radial, 'B' for bias belt or 'D' for diagonal.

Which 225 50 R17 tyre types can I buy from Protyre?
At Protyre, we supply and fit 225/50 R17 tyres in a range of types including:
225 50 R17 all season tyres are a versatile option designed to be used all year round.
225 50 R17 winter tyres are designed to handle the Winter period when conditions become more wet and icy.
225 50 R17 run flat tyres which are designed to allow drivers to safely continue driving for a short distance following a puncture.
